Clint Black's New Circle Network Series Kicks Off A Conversation With Darius Rucker
The series premieres this Saturday, May 22 at 10pm ET.

Opry member and Grammy-winning country superstar Clint Black is hosting and co-producing a new series, Talking in Circles with Clint Black, which will premiere on Circle Network on Saturday, May 22 at 10pm ET/9pm CT following Opry Live. The first episode will kick off a conversation with award-winning country artist Darius Rucker. (A trailer clip with photos can be found here).
"I've had the best time talking in circles with my guests and so honored they showed up for me," Black said. "I can't wait for our premiere episode to air!"
The initial season also features episodes with Brad Paisley, Vince Gill, Amy Grant, Rodney Crowell, Keb' Mo, John Rich, Travis Tritt, Steve Wariner, Trace Adkins and Sara Evans.
"I have known Clint for years, and we were just two friends chatting about the music business and kinda forgot that the cameras were rolling,'' commented singer-songwriter Sara Evans. "We honestly could have talked for hours."
